Broadcasting & Cable reports on the House Commerce, Manufacturing and Trade Subcommittee’s creation of a bipartisan privacy working group to focus on online privacy. With Reps. Marsha Blackburn (R-TN) and Peter Welch (D-VT) as its chairs, the working group will also include Reps. Joe Barton (R-TX), Pete Olson (R-TX), Mike Pompeo (R-KS), Jan Schakowsky (D-IL), Bobby Rush (D-IL) and Jerry McNerney (D-CA). Blackburn said the working group will “seek opportunities where Congress can forge bipartisan agreement to better protect consumers' sensitive information and foster U.S.-based innovation," while Welch added that given advancements in technology, it is “more important than ever that we make sure the consumer's right to privacy is protected.”
